Brazil Gets Unreal: A Series of Lectures

By Andy Hess

Epic Games is excited to announce Brazil Gets Unreal, a series of lectures showcasing the use of Unreal Engine. Conducted in partnership with Universidade Federal Fluminense, Polytechnic School of the University of São Paulo, Faculdades Integradas Barros Melo, and Universidade de Fortaleza, Brazil Gets Unreal begins May 4, 2015.

Brazil Gets Unreal is a 6 hour lecture series intended to provide an overview of UE4, and instruct on the core-principles of building your game using Unreal Engine. Features such as Blueprints, Paper 2D, physically based materials, and Unreal Motion Graphics will be covered, along with advanced topics such as the use of C++ with Blueprints, asset management, and collaborative development.
